WebJun 22, 2024 · Then, dissolve at least two parts sugar into one part water and pour the mixture into the bottom of the bottle so that it’s a few inches full. Complete the trap by taking the cap off the bottle, flipping the top part upside down, and setting it inside the bottom of the bottle. Now, it’s ready to go outside, anywhere you want to keep wasps away. WebMay 4, 2024 · 2 teaspoons liquid dish soap String for suspending bait Scissors to cut string Instructions Fill the bucket with water. Add liquid dish soap and slightly mix with the water. Set bucket where you can suspend the bait above it. Cut a string long enough so the bait is about 1" from the water surface.
